ES Residence
Bintaro, South Tangerang, 2025

Elevating the space expands its horizon. The house is condensed and organized into three different sections, where the living and bedroom quarters are elevated one floor higher. The service quarters occupy the ground floor below, hidden behind a sloping garden.

Detaching the house from its neighbours and making the most of the corner site allows ample openings on all its four sides, ensures all-day natural light and cross ventilation within the living space. Concrete block walls control the privacy of the interior space.
